The National Nuclear Institute visited the welding engineering works at KMUTT.

On October 9, 2024, the Welding Engineering Research and Services Center (KINGWELD), under the Institute for Scientific and Technological Research and Services (ISTRS), King Mongkut’s University of Technology Thonburi (KMUTT), welcomed a group of study visitors and experts from the National Nuclear Institute (Public Organization) (TINT) to visit and study welding engineering and destructive and non-destructive inspection at the Production Engineering Department Conference Room (B11-901).

Assoc.Prof.Dr. BOVORNCHOK POOPAT, Head of WELDING RESEARCH AND CONSULTING CENTER (KINGWELD), welcomed and led the group to visit the Engineering Department and various laboratories, which consist of the Welding Laboratory and the Destructive and Non-Destructive Testing Laboratory. KINGWELD Center is recognized for its modern equipment and technologies used in testing and inspection, such as ISO 17025 certified mechanical testing and non-destructive testing using high-frequency ultrasonic, eddy current, penetrant, magnetic powder, radiography, and Acoustic Emission testing.

The purpose of this visit is to enhance knowledge in welding engineering and related inspection processes to further develop work in this field, as well as to create further collaboration between the National Nuclear Institute and the Welding Engineering Research and Service Center (KINGWELD), King Mongkut’s University of Technology Thonburi.
